A Genuine Home-Cooked Introduction to Rajasthani Food
The experience is hosted in a real Jaipur home, where the warmth of Indian hospitality shines. You’ll start with a welcome drink, easing into the atmosphere before rolling up your sleeves. The class is designed to be hands-on and interactive, with plenty of opportunities to ask questions and learn about each step of cooking traditional dishes.
During the session, you’ll learn to prepare classic Rajasthani dishes like dal baati churma, a hearty combination of baked wheat balls, lentils, and sweet crushed wheat. Also, you’ll get to make ker sangri, a local vegetable mix that’s often enjoyed with roti. The instructor, who is part of the local family, shares the stories behind each ingredient. For example, you’ll understand why certain spices are used and how they originated, adding depth to your culinary knowledge.
The Kitchen Experience: From Ingredients to Plates
One of the tour’s highlights is the introduction to Indian spices and ingredients. You’ll see and smell a variety of spices—cumin, coriander, turmeric, and more—and learn how each contributes to the flavor profile of Rajasthan’s dishes. This makes the entire cooking process more meaningful, transforming it from mere recipe replication into a cultural exchange.
You’ll also get your hands on making chapatis and vegetable curries, which are essential parts of Indian meals. The guide ensures that even beginners feel comfortable, offering tips on kneading dough or simmering spices just right. As you cook, the host shares anecdotes about how these dishes are traditionally prepared and enjoyed in Rajasthan.
Savoring Your Creations and Beyond
Once the cooking is complete, you’ll sit down to enjoy the meal together, savoring the flavors of Rajasthan. The experience isn’t just about eating; it’s about appreciating the food’s journey and the stories behind it. Guests often mention the warm, welcoming atmosphere, which makes even a short visit feel like coming home.
Afterward, you’ll receive e-recipes of all the dishes you’ve made, allowing you to recreate these at home. This is a practical touch that extends the value of the experience beyond your Jaipur trip.

FAQ
Is transportation included in the tour?
No, transportation to and from the meeting point is not included. You’ll need to arrange your own way to get there, such as a tuk-tuk, taxi, or on foot.
What dishes will I learn to prepare?
You’ll learn to cook traditional Rajasthani dishes like dal baati churma, ker sangri, chapatis, vegetable curries, and an Indian dessert.
Are ingredients provided?
Yes, all necessary ingredients and spices are provided for the cooking class.
Can I participate if I have food allergies or dietary restrictions?
The tour description does not specify accommodations for dietary restrictions, so it’s best to inquire beforehand or be prepared to adapt the recipes at home.
How long does the experience last?
The class typically lasts a few hours, enough time to cook, eat, and ask questions comfortably.
What language is the class conducted in?
The class is conducted in English and Hindi, making it accessible for most travelers.
Is this experience suitable for children?
While not explicitly stated, the hands-on nature and cultural focus make it suitable for older children or teens who enjoy cooking.
What is the cost?
The experience costs $20 per person, offering excellent value for a genuine local cooking experience.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, providing flexibility for your travel plans.
